Yes, provided it is properly stored and the can is undamaged - commercially packaged beef broth will typically carry a "Best By," "Best if Used By," "Best Before", or "Best When Used By" date but this is not a safety date, it is the manufacturer's estimate of how long the beef broth will remain at peak quality. If the broth develops foul smell, discoloration, or even mold growth, it is also time to discard the remaining product. Storage time shown is for best quality only - after that, the beef broth's texture, color or flavor may change, but in most cases, it will still be safe to consume if it has been stored properly, the can is undamaged, and there are no signs of spoilage (see below). The best way is to smell and look at the beef broth: if the beef broth develops an off odor, flavor or appearance, or if mold appears, it should be discarded.
